Taper bushes also known as taper lock bushes are a tapered, non-flanged, split bushing that utilises allen head grub screws to tighten or pull them into a reducing taper socket squeezing them onto the shaft they are being mounted upon, thus providing excellent clamping force for securing a vast range of pulleys, sprockets, flanged hubs and couplers.

These bushes are utilised on pulleys and sprockets to increase the clamping force over standard bored-to-size products that only use a keyway and set screw to lock onto the shaft.
